  11. April 2015 Investor Presentation – Cardinal Energy Ltd. – slide 11
    Asset Characteristics Base production decline rate approximately 10% 97% operated production 90% working interest 92% oil weighted Concentrated in 2 Core Areas Multi year drilling inventory 11 11
  12. April 2015 Investor Presentation – Cardinal Energy Ltd. – slide 12
    Cardinal Asset Base Solid Base of Oil Production from 2 Core Areas Wainwright Approximately 5,500 boe/d production forecast for Q1 2015 Bantry Approximately 5,700 boe/d production forecast for Q1 2015 Both areas have extensive…
  13. April 2015 Investor Presentation – Cardinal Energy Ltd. – slide 13
    Wainwright Dominant land position with over 55 sections of land Oil production under waterflood with less than 10% decline 98% operated, average 95% working interest Control key infrastructure By pass uphole drilling targets…
  14. April 2015 Investor Presentation – Cardinal Energy Ltd. – slide 14
    Wainwright Drilling Average well cost 1.0 mm (estimated) IP (365) < 40,000/flowing boe Reserves 83 mboe(1) F&D 12.05/boe(1) Multiyear drilling inventory in excess of 30 locations Only 2.5 net locations booked 1. Based on TPP…
  15. April 2015 Investor Presentation – Cardinal Energy Ltd. – slide 15
    Wainwright Sparky Pools Large oil in place (241 mmbbls) The Wainwright B pool is a model for the Wainwright Sparky Pools Due to effective line drive water flood the recovery is 45% to date Current 2P reserve bookings forecast a…
  16. April 2015 Investor Presentation – Cardinal Energy Ltd. – slide 16
    Bantry Dominant land position with over 246 sections of land 97% operated, average 94% working interest oil production Solid Glauc drilling results to date with over 80 locations identified. The majority of base production is…
